East Greenwich Crews Douse Fire At The High School
A fire broke out Saturday night at East Greenwich High and caused "extensive smoke damage," Firefighter William Perry reported.

EAST GREENWICH, RI — A fire broke out around 8 p.m. Saturday at East Greenwich High. It was put out quickly but caused smoke damage. Firefighter William Perry reports the school officials and the fire marshal have been notified.
